Patrick Desgrenier is a Concept Artist working with Ubisoft Montreal on the Assassin's Creed series, where his specialization lies in matte painting of landscape images and gameplay background concepts. Recently, he was a Lead Team Artist in Raphael Lacoste's art concept team on Assassin's Creed: Revelations.

Trivia
- Desgrenier was one of the members of the scouting team to modern-day Constantinople (Istanbul), alongside Falko Poiker and Raphael Lacoste.
